1. Protein Supplements

Protein is essential for muscle repair and growth, especially if you’re starting a new workout regimen. Beginners can benefit from protein powders, such as:

  1. Whey Protein – Fast-absorbing and ideal for post-workout recovery.
  2. Casein Protein – Slow-digesting, suitable for nighttime use.
  3. Plant-Based Proteins – Great for vegans and those with dairy sensitivities.

2. Creatine

Creatine is one of the most researched supplements in the fitness industry. It helps to enhance strength and power, making it beneficial for beginners who want to maximize their workouts. Key benefits include:

  • Improved energy production during high-intensity activities.
  • Enhanced recovery between sets.
  • Support for increased muscle mass over time.

3. Multivitamins

While focusing on macronutrients, it’s crucial not to overlook micronutrients. A quality multivitamin can fill in gaps in your diet and ensure you are obtaining necessary vitamins and minerals, contributing to overall health and performance. Look for:

  1. Vitamins A, C, D, and E for immune support.
  2. Minerals like magnesium, zinc, and calcium for muscle function and recovery.

4. Omega-3 Fatty Acids

Incorporating Omega-3 supplements (like fish oil) can aid in reducing inflammation and promoting heart health. The benefits include:

  • Potential for faster recovery from workouts.
  • Support for joint health.
  • Improvement in overall mood and cognitive function.

5. Pre-Workout Supplements

For those looking to boost their energy and performance before workouts, pre-workout supplements can provide an edge. Look for ingredients such as:

  1. Caffeine – Increases energy and focus.
  2. BCAAs – Helps with muscle endurance.
  3. Beta-Alanine – Reduces fatigue during prolonged exercise.
